It'll be uncomfortable as fuck for the first little bit. I would do your best to make friends with people, and do things that you haven't done before, or have been scared to do. When I went to rehab I never went cliff diving before, and got a chance to do that there. Do lots of exercise, that shit helps a ton when you're getting off the drugs.

If your rehab allows it bring some music to listen to, books are good as well. The rehab I went to let us bring our laptops, so I was able to have a ton of movies on it which was dope.

Also chances are someone at your rehab is going to do drugs there, and might even offer it to you, as hard as it might be say no.
